Mental Health Substance Use Care Manager collaborating with community hospitals and stakeholders. Focused on proactive intervention and care management for mental health and substance use services.
Responsibilities
Provide education, referrals, care management activities surrounding available services and supports including Physical Health, Behavioral Health, I/DD, LTSS, TBI, Pharmacy, Vision, and Dental services/supports.
Link to needed behavioral health and physical health care services and facilitating appropriate connections to primary healthcare services through Community Care of North Carolina, the Health Department, or other community health resources
Coordinating and linking members to benefits
Complete initial and yearly Care Management Comprehensive Assessment and Care Plan
Conduct Care Team meetings and ensure treatment team members participate in treatment team meetings to address the needs of the member
Conduct continuous monitoring of progress towards goals identified in Care Plan through in-person and collateral contacts with the member and member's supports, including family, information and formal caregivers and routine care team reviews
Identify the gaps in needed services and intervene as needed to ensure the member receives appropriate care
Identify and refer member to community resources
Oversee care transitions for members who are moving from one clinical setting to another
Maintain accurate tracking and data information for care management activities and outcomes including tracking of individuals in and out of services, those who are on waiting lists, those who need follow-up, and those on outpatient commitments
Serves as a collaborative partner in identifying system barriers through work with community stakeholders
Manages and facilitates Child/Adult High Risk Team meetings in collaboration with DSS, DJJ, school systems, CCNC Care Managers, and other community stakeholders as appropriate
